Doesn't matter what he deserves. Even if you believe he doesn't deserve it, he's a legit 7 footer, so he's going to get more than he deserves.

His scoring, rebounding (including offensive rebounding), blocks, and steals have improved each year he's been in the league.

He's improved his post moves & his face up game.

Also, he's yet to average 30 minutes per game for a season. Per 36, he's averaging 16 & 9 for his career and averaged 15.5 & 10.6 this past season.

He just averaged 11.7, 11.2, and 3.1 (blocks) in the postseason in 31 minutes per night.

He's going to get the Max, if not pretty damn close.

Max deal though? Hibbert's career high is 13 PPG. When the ratio of millions of dollars to points is worse than 1:1, it's never good.

Hibbert deserves a Varejao contract, not a max.

If you aren't high on Jefferson, that's fine. Keep in mind next year's Center Free Agent Class:

1) Dwight Howard
2) Al Jefferson
3) Andrew Bynum
4) Brook Lopez

Add in a crazy-heavy center draft next year, and it's foolish to hand out 9 figures to Roy Hibbert this summer.

Especially when we would be paying him about 35-40 million short of 9 figures. The max we can offer is something around 60-62million for 4 years.

I definitely agree that Cavs should aim to maintain flexibility for big free agent pool in 2013. But it helps that they will have expiring contracts of Casspi/Gibson/Walton next summer (~13 million according to Hoopshype), so as long as they're responsible this summer and don't spend a ton, they have enough space to add/keep a couple of FAs this summer and still pursue a big free agent like Harden next summer. I didn't see it, but how much money do we have to spend this summer?

We're at about $46m counting AV, Walton, Kyrie, Boobie, TT, Casspi and Baron Davis. We still have the option to not have BD's hold count, which would free up more room. With our picks, deciding to keep BD's hold, and filling out the roster ... we don't HAVE to spend a dime to meet the salary floor
